Formed in 2001, The Duhks (pronounced like "ducks") are a five-piece Canadian folk-rock group. Four of them are from Winnipeg, Manitoba. Their music draws heavily on Celtic traditions, but is also influenced by gospel music, bluegrass, and other North American musical traditions, and uses acoustic instruments with rock and Latin-influenced percussion. In spring 2016, the band announced that they would no longer be touring. They have not released any new music since 2014.
